Show Notes

This episode features special guest David, a Patreon supporter at the highest level! David has chosen the CBS Radio Workshop adaptation of Aldous Huxley’s Brave New World, told in two parts. Thanks, David! Huxley himself narrated this version of his classic dystopic vision. In the future, industry has completely eclipsed morality, and hedonism has replaced emotional connections. But opportunity knocks when an outsider is introduced to this world. Do the horrors of this Brave New World actually hold some appeal? Which parts of the novel’s predictions have come to pass? Were there radio artists who specialized in butt foley? Listen for yourself and find out!
